WebDec 8, 2016 · The Eventbrite fee is 2.0% of ticket price + .99 per transaction; There is a 3% credit card processing fee in addition to that if credit cards are used; Note: There is a max of $7.95 per ticket for the Eventbrite fee, there will still be a 3% credit card processing fee on top of that when allowing credit cards for payment. WebIf you're hosting a paid event, Eventbrite Payment Processing is the default method for accepting payments online. Eventbrite sends your payout 3 days after the completion of your event or on the custom payout schedule you choose. Then, your bank and location will determine how long it takes for the money to show in your account.
